The bachelor's program at MSU Denver was ranked #61 on College Factual's Best Schools for ee tech list. It is also ranked #1 in Colorado.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, Metropolitan State University of Denver handed out 19 bachelor's degrees in electronics engineering technology. This is an increase of 73% over the previous year when 11 degrees were handed out.
The median salary of ee tech students who receive their bachelor's degree at MSU Denver is $62,003. This is higher than $60,951, which is the national median for all ee tech bachelor's degree recipients.
While getting their bachelor's degree at MSU Denver, ee tech students borrow a median amount of $26,500 in student loans. This is not too bad considering that the median debt load of all ee tech bachelor's degree recipients across the country is $31,000.

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the ee tech majors at Metropolitan State University of Denver.
In the 2020-2021 academic year, 19 students earned a bachelor's degree in ee tech from MSU Denver. About 11% of these graduates were women and the other 89% were men.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Metropolitan State University of Denver with a bachelor's in ee tech.
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
---|---|
Asian | 2 |
Black or African American | 1 |
Hispanic or Latino | 4 |
White | 9 |
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
Other Races | 3 |
